文章原址:

http://923080512.iteye.com/blog/1401696

web.xml中配置spring的几种方式

  • 博客分类:
  • spring
springweb.xml 
spring有三种启动方式,使用ContextLoaderServlet,ContextLoaderListener和ContextLoaderPlugIn
spring3.0及以后版本中已经删除ContextLoaderServlet 和Log4jConfigServlet
可以采用余下两种启动方式ContextLoaderListener和ContextLoaderPlugIn
建议使用ContextLoaderListener
。
 N0:1

       <!--推荐使用此种方式-->

       <listener><listener-class>org.springframework.web.context.ContextLoaderListener</listener-class></listener> <!--contextConfigLocation在 ContextLoaderListener类中的默认值是 /WEB-INF/applicationContext.xml--><context-param><param-name>contextConfigLocation</param-name><param-value>/WEB-INF/applicationContext.xml</param-value><!-- <param-value>classpath:applicationContext*.xml</param-value> --></context-param>
N0:2 <!--spring3.0之后不再支持此种方式--><servlet><servlet-name>context</servlet-name><servlet-class>org.springframework.web.context.ContextLoaderServlet</servlet-class><load-on-startup>1</load-on-startup></servlet>-->N0:3<!--要导入org.springframework.web.struts-3.0.5.RELEASE.jar包,在struts2.0及以后版本不支持此种方式加载spring-->    <plug-in className="org.springframework.web.struts.ContextLoaderPlugIn"><set-property property="contextConfigLocation" value="/WEB-INF/applicationContext.xml"/></plug-in>

web.xml中配置spring的几种方式相关推荐

  1. web.config中配置数据库连接的两种方式

    在网站开发中,数据库操作是经常要用到的操作,ASP.NET中一般做法是在web.config中配置数据库连接代码,然后在程序中调用数据库连接代码,这样做的好处就是当数据库连接代码需要改变的时候,我们只 ...

  2. appsettings 连接oracle数据库,web.config中配置数据库连接的两种方式(appSettings 与 connectionStrings)...

    [预览] [转载博客]cnblogs.com/sunzhiyue/archive/2011/06/07/2074696.html 在网站开发中,数据库操作是经常要用到的操作,ASP.NET中一般做法是 ...

  3. 深入理解web.xml中配置/和/*的区别

    在用SpringMVC进行web开发的时候,如果将DispathcerServlet对外访问的虚拟路径配置成/时,需要在Spring的配置文件中配置<mvc:default-servlet-ha ...

  4. SpringMVC在web.xml中配置DispatcherServlet拦截了静态资源访问

    如图 在web.xml中配置DispatcherServlet时对于url-pattern的配置方式有以下几种情况: 1.配置为: *.do 或者是 *.action 时,拦截以.do或者.actio ...

  5. Web.xml中配置监听器Listener导致Tomcat无法启动

    Web.xml中配置监听器Listener导致Tomcat无法启动 1.在pom.xml里导入 org.springframework spring-web 5.0.5.RELEASE 版本看你个人的 ...

  6. 在web.xml中配置过滤器

    在web.xml中配置过滤器 <filter> <filter-name>loginFilter</filter-name>//过滤器名称 <filter-c ...

  7. web.xml中配置web监听器

    web.xml中配置web监听器 在web.xml配置监听器,格式如下: <listener><listener-class>类全名</listener-class> ...

  8. 在配置文件web.xml中配置Struts2的启动信息

    在配置文件web.xml中配置Struts2的启动信息: <?xml version="1.0" encoding="UTF-8"?> <we ...

  9. 服务器启动时Webapp的web.xml中配置的加载顺序

    一 1.启动一个WEB项目的时候,WEB容器会去读取它的配置文件web.xml,读取<listener>和<context-param>两个结点. 2.紧急着,容创建一个Ser ...

  10. web.xml中,spring模块化加载xml方式

    1:web.xml中添加监听器. <listener><listener-class>org.springframework.web.context.ContextLoader ...

最新文章

  1. 博为峰Java技术文章 ——JavaSE Swing FlowLayout布局管理器I
  2. VS集成opencv编译C++项目遇到的问题
  3. Gradient Tree Boosting:梯度提升树详解
  4. linux下安装php扩展模块gettext
  5. Office PPT如何切换到返回幻灯片
  6. svn备份遇到的问题
  7. 注意!这些行为将会影响征信
  8. MailBee.NET Objects发送电子邮件(SMTP)教程六:创建并发送带有附件的邮件
  9. mongodb学习笔记之增删改查作指令
  10. HTML5等先关。。。
  11. 真正的帅哥没人说帅_“浩南哥”这话你敢信?郑伊健:在香港,没人夸我帅
  12. I.MX6 dhcpcd 需要指定网卡
  13. BIOS修改mbr为gpt的步骤
  14. 一些思考:腾讯股价为何持续都低
  15. 基因组测序为什么没完没了?
  16. poi向excel插入图片demo
  17. anaconda 创建虚拟环境(自己版本)
  18. python之tkinter Pack使用
  19. 安利 Access denied for user root @ localhost错误
  20. 视频教程-手把手实现Java图书管理系统(附源码)-Java

热门文章

  1. Irrlicht引擎例子说明及中文链接
  2. Java中PreparedStatement和Statement区别
  3. mysql数据迁移到sqlserver_技术分享 | 使用OGG实现Oracle到MySQL数据平滑迁移
  4. 华为harmonyos官方微博账号,华为 EMUI 官方微信和微博更名为 HarmonyOS
  5. java加密不可逆,32位不可逆加密算法Java实现
  6. 服务器是怎么响应服务器的细节,我怎样才能得到响应从Web服务器
  7. python rsi_使用python与rsi进行算法交易
  8. matlab畸变程度计算,matlab 畸变校正代码
  9. C/C++[codeup 1962]单词替换
  10. 深度神经网络 分布式训练 动手学深度学习v2